An open API service indexing awesome lists of open source software.

Projects in Awesome Lists tagged with structs

A curated list of projects in awesome lists tagged with structs .

https://github.com/ianstormtaylor/superstruct

A simple and composable way to validate data in JavaScript (and TypeScript).

interface javascript schema structs types typescript validation

Last synced: 14 May 2025

https://github.com/fatih/structs

Utilities for Go structs

go golang structs

Last synced: 05 Oct 2025

https://github.com/fatih/gomodifytags

Go tool to modify struct field tags

go golang structs tags tool

Last synced: 18 Jul 2025

https://github.com/ompluscator/dynamic-struct

Golang package for editing struct's fields during runtime and mapping structs to other structs.

dynamic go golang runtime structs

Last synced: 16 May 2025

https://github.com/fatih/structtag

Parse and modify Go struct field tags

go structs tags

Last synced: 14 May 2025

https://github.com/spatie/typed

Improvements to PHP's type system in userland: generics, typed lists, tuples and structs

generics structs tuples types

Last synced: 09 Jul 2025

https://github.com/1pkg/gopium

Gopium 🌺: Smart Go Structures Optimizer and Manager

align false-sharing go go-vscode golang padding structs tool

Last synced: 07 May 2025

https://github.com/mashingan/smapping

Golang struct generic mapping

go golang golang-library reflection structs

Last synced: 06 May 2025

https://github.com/arturdev/structify

Convert Swift structs to Objc Classes on the fly!

class objective-c realm struct struct-to-class structs swift

Last synced: 19 Aug 2025

https://github.com/mozillazg/go-httpheader

A Go library for encoding structs into Header fields.

go go-library golang header struct structs

Last synced: 26 Jun 2025

https://github.com/mozillazg/Go-httpheader

A Go library for encoding structs into Header fields.

go go-library golang header struct structs

Last synced: 12 Mar 2025

https://github.com/ruby2elixir/atomic_map

A small utility to convert deep Elixir maps with mixed string/atom keys to atom-only keyed maps.

elixir helper structs

Last synced: 21 Aug 2025

https://github.com/miracl/conflate

Library providing routines to merge and validate JSON, YAML and/or TOML files

config configuration configuration-management golang golang-library json json-schema merge structs toml yaml

Last synced: 13 Apr 2025

https://github.com/ThundR67/straf

Convert Golang Struct To GraphQL Object On The Fly

go golang graphql graphql-query graphql-schema struct structs structtographql

Last synced: 14 Mar 2025

https://github.com/thundr67/straf

Convert Golang Struct To GraphQL Object On The Fly

go golang graphql graphql-query graphql-schema struct structs structtographql

Last synced: 27 Oct 2025

https://github.com/samuelgiles/sorbet-struct-comparable

Comparable T::Struct's for the equality focused typed Ruby developer.

compare comparison equality equals ruby sorbet struct structs type-safety typed types

Last synced: 08 Oct 2025

https://github.com/gamemann/glib-tests

A repository I'm using to learn hashing with GLib.

c fast ghash glib glib2-0 hash pkg-config structs structures

Last synced: 18 Mar 2025

https://github.com/am-kantox/pyc

Set of additional functionality for structs

elixir elixir-lang structs

Last synced: 26 Mar 2025

https://github.com/dashxhq/sanitizer

Dead easy sanitizing for rust structs

rust sanitize structs

Last synced: 21 Aug 2025

https://github.com/cthulhu/go-steun

Collection of small things gopher needs for everyday projects

fixtures golang pointer pointers retry structs timeid tools uri

Last synced: 17 Jul 2025

https://github.com/spigwitmer/golang_struct_builder

IDA 7.0+ script that auto-generates structs and interfaces from runtime metadata found in golang binaries

golang ida ida7 more-structs reverse-engineering structs

Last synced: 10 May 2025

https://github.com/zookzook/yildun

Yildun is a white-hued star in the northern circumpolar constellation of Ursa Minor, forming the second star in the bear's tail. And it is a very small library to support structs while using the MongoDB driver for Elixir.

driver elixir maps mongodb structs

Last synced: 08 Aug 2025

https://github.com/hunterdii/30-days-of-rust

🦀 30 Days of Rust is a daily challenge to guide you through Rust programming essentials. From basics to advanced, this repo offers 📚 clear examples, 🔧 practical exercises, and 🎯 resources to help you master Rust, one day at a time. Whether you're new or refining your skills, this challenge has something for you. Join the journey now! 🚀

30-days-of-rust asynchronous-programming building-cli-applications cargos-and-package collections-rust control-flows-rust enums file-and-error-handling funtions-rust generics github integration ownership-and-borrowing rust rust-and-ml rust-and-webassembly rust-lang structs traits webdevelopment

Last synced: 22 Aug 2025

https://github.com/skryvvara/address-book

A trivial address-book written with C | Used Visual-Studio C++ Project therefore code files end with .cpp

c structs

Last synced: 06 Sep 2025

https://github.com/badu/stroo

Generator using template which sit in your projects - no dependency required

generator go golang structs template tool

Last synced: 27 Aug 2025

https://github.com/joegasewicz/butter

Merge Go structs

go structs structs-go

Last synced: 05 Apr 2025

https://github.com/rhaseven7h/sqljson

SQL+JSON+Validator Support for sql.NullString, sql.NullBool, sql.NullInt64 and sql.NullFloat64.

field go golang json json-serialization marhsaller marshalling null sql struct structs unmarshaller unmarshalling validate validator validators

Last synced: 14 Mar 2025

https://github.com/unkaktus/name

get names of Go structs, funcs, http.Handlers

funcs go names structs

Last synced: 23 Oct 2025

https://github.com/tebogoyungmercykay/computer_organisation_and_architecture

Topic-level detail and learning outcomes for each of these areas are given by the first six units of `Architecture and Organisation' knowledge area as specified by the ACM/IEEE Computer Science Curriculum 2013

64 64-bit 64bit-assembly assembly c c-programming-language functions intel makefile objconv pointers pointers-and-arrays registers shell stack structs user-input x86-64

Last synced: 14 Mar 2025

https://github.com/corebreaker/gobincodec

Binary format for serialization of Golang typed datas.

binary-data binaryformat codec encoder-decoder encoding go golang struct structs structure structures

Last synced: 08 Apr 2025

https://github.com/iricartb/university-seven-half-card-game-sockets

Ivan Ricart Borges - Simulation of the seven and a half card game through the use of sockets.

c client-server fork memory-sharing multiplayer processes sockets structs video-game

Last synced: 03 Mar 2025

https://github.com/sohaib90/dynamic_array

Implementation of a dynamic array in c

c dynamic-arrays structs

Last synced: 18 Mar 2025

https://github.com/guidanoli/inf1018

Basic Software (INF1018) Assignements

compiler structs

Last synced: 20 Jun 2025

https://github.com/abitofhelp/minipipeline

A Go application exploring more complexity with interfaces, structs, and channels for implementing a pipeline.

channels go golang interfaces pipeline structs

Last synced: 18 Mar 2025

https://github.com/anjanasenanayake/word-counter

Word/Character counter of a given source file programmed in C

c character-counter linked-list linkedlist pointers structs word-counter word-frequency

Last synced: 28 Feb 2025

https://github.com/furui/gofaced

Go package interface generator

generator go golang interface interfaces mocks package structs testing tests

Last synced: 26 Mar 2025

https://github.com/ruggi/env

Automatically set Go struct fields values with environment variables

env environment-variables go golang structs

Last synced: 14 Oct 2025

https://github.com/cheesycoffee/envparser

A lightweight Go package for parsing environment variables into struct fields using tags

env environment-variables golang golang-library struct structs

Last synced: 28 Oct 2025

https://github.com/yefremov/golib

Collection of useful Go functions, structs and data types

go lib structs utils

Last synced: 09 Oct 2025

https://github.com/gabrdsp/swift

Coleção educacional completa criada para ensinar programação em Swift passo a passo — desde fundamentos até um projeto prático. Cada arquivo apresenta conceitos-chave de programação com exemplos claros, comentários explicativos e aplicações reais.

book-management classes computed-properties educacional functions inheritance library-system methods object-oriented-programming oop optional-values static-method structs swift swift-examples swift-tutorial user-management

Last synced: 10 Oct 2025

https://github.com/izalouyza/sistemagerenciamentopedidosrestaurante

Este repositório refere-se ao trabalho da primeira unidade da disciplina de Estrutura de Dados I (PEX1241).

alocacao-dinamica enums ponteiros strings-com-ponteiros structs vetores-dinamicos

Last synced: 30 Jul 2025

https://github.com/sandra1me/c-task-manager

A beginner-friendly command-line Task Manager written in C. You can create tasks with a name, description, date, and priority, and manage them by marking them as completed or deleting them.

beginner-project c c-programming cli console-application menu-driven-program structs task-manager

Last synced: 08 Sep 2025

https://github.com/izalouyza/filadeprioridadehospital

Este repositório refere-se ao trabalho da terceira unidade da disciplina de Estruturas de Dados I (PEX1241).

arraydinamico filadeprioridade priorityqueue structs

Last synced: 30 Jul 2025

https://github.com/awaescher/fluentstructures

Fluent APIs to simplify the handling of structs in .NET

fluent fluent-api intent structs structures

Last synced: 03 Aug 2025

https://github.com/simpson-computer-technologies-research/carray

Pointer and non-pointer array strcture in C

array c pointers structs

Last synced: 22 Mar 2025

https://github.com/weiwenchen2022/merge

merge: deeply merge arbitrary values in Golang

go golang mapping merge structs

Last synced: 24 Dec 2025

https://github.com/simpsonresearch/carray

Pointer and non-pointer array strcture in C

array c pointers structs

Last synced: 31 Aug 2025

https://github.com/xpodev/quickstruct

A library to ease the creation of C structs in Python

cpython cstruct data-structures python python-3 python3 struct structs structure structures

Last synced: 14 May 2025

https://github.com/vfsoraki/grimoire

Supercharged Elixir structs

elixir structs

Last synced: 23 Mar 2025

https://github.com/pchchv/sfj

Generator of Go structs from JSON server responses.

go go-lib go-library go-package golang golang-library golang-package json response structs structures

Last synced: 05 Apr 2025

https://github.com/liyuhi/filadeprioridadehospital

Este repositório refere-se ao trabalho da terceira unidade da disciplina de Estruturas de Dados I.

arraydinamico filadeprioridade priorityqueue structs

Last synced: 22 Apr 2025

https://github.com/liyuhi/sistemagerenciamentopedidosrestaurante

Este repositório refere-se ao trabalho da primeira unidade da disciplina de Estrutura de Dados I.

alocacao-dinamica enums ponteiros strings-com-ponteiros structs vetores-dinamicos

Last synced: 22 Apr 2025

https://github.com/weiwenchen2022/structof

Utilities for Go structs

go golang structs

Last synced: 24 Dec 2025